Some features of the project in development process to be launched as a research and development plataform for autonomous wildfire supression technology:
- Unreal Engine or GAZEBO enviroment built on ROS 2
- Build the terrain using realworld map data
- The software will simulate the dispersion of fire using an algorithm. Also calculate the wind effect.
- This simulation will have drones and quadruped robots. Developers (eg cooperative participants) will be able to use these tools.
- Image processing can be done with cameras on robots and drones.
- The software will simulate the progress of the fire
- The administrator will use an interface to control wind speed, wind direction and similar physical and environmental elements with simulation settings made in an interface.
-Computer models using data, math and computer instructions to predict events in the real world.
-Data-driven forest fire analysis (information about real time or historical data conditions) from a burning area, transform it into a simulation environment and obtain the best fire-fighting strategy.
-Reality-based generation of virtual environments for digital earth (mixture of real and virtual imagery), using satellite/aerial images and maps, virtual, augmented, and mixed reality combined.
-Simulating the forest fire plume dispersion, chemistry, and aerosol formation
- AI to control drones and quadruped robo: Deep Reinforcement Learning
